				Re: Canon Magic Lantern
			 
 
			
			I've used this for years and never had any issues.  it doesn't overwrite anything as it's installed on the removable media.  holding down the Set button on startup bypasses it by not loading it, so you just get the standard features installed on the camera via firmware.
